In the case of small motor sizes (such as PSx motors sizes M, N and 0 or motors of other manufacturers) with MC6000 Servocontrollers thermal monitoring by the motor PTC is inadequate for dynamic operation with overload. In such cases the overall design should be checked with LUST to avoid the motor being destroyed. However, the MC7000 Servocontrollers are designed for operating small motors. The I² x t - protection switches off if the motor is overloaded. Issue: November 1995 3-11
